Transaction 596726292413e42d929c7b6b0108f47ae5ba7f696473f522758133621ab1fd3b

1 Input
2 Outputs
  • 596726292413e42d929c7b6b0108f47ae5ba7f696473f522758133621ab1fd3b:0
  • value  3045290
    address  3FZAiiX35ZmkFpekK8Pd7YfxpFVyRkhedd
  • 596726292413e42d929c7b6b0108f47ae5ba7f696473f522758133621ab1fd3b:1
  • value  9070488
    address  1Dygba89GBCEwLRSnFzU4vFtJvuG1ftz3o